Navigating the Technical Details
One of the most common hurdles for new sublimation enthusiasts is understanding file formats and sizing. This particular package includes a 5 in x 5 in PNG file at 300 DPI. Why does this matter? In the world of print, resolution is king. A 72 DPI image might look fine on a screen, but when transferred to a ceramic or plastic surface, it will look blurry and amateurish. The 300 DPI standard ensures professional-grade results.
Furthermore, the "3D" aspect of the design refers to the wrap capability. Unlike a standard flat sticker, this design is intended to cover the curvature of a ball ornament. When you purchase this instant digital download, you are getting a file that has likely been distorted slightly in the preview to account for the stretching that occurs during the heating process. This means less trial and error for you. You don't need to be a graphic designer to make it fit; the work has been done to ensure the cardinal sits correctly on the front of the ornament without weird warping on the sides.
What to Consider Before You Download
While the possibilities are exciting, there are practical considerations to keep in mind to ensure success. First, remember that this is a digital file only. No physical ornaments, ink, or paper will arrive in your mailbox. You need to have access to a sublimation printer, sublimation ink, sublimation paper, and a heat source capable of handling round objects, such as an oven or a specialized mug/ornament press.
Secondly, consider your color management. Sublimation relies on heat to turn ink into gas, which then bonds with polymer-coated surfaces. The vibrant red of the cardinal in the 3D Red Cardinal Christmas Ornament 4 design is striking, but your final output depends on your printer profile and the quality of your blank ornaments. Always run a test print on regular paper to check sizing and color balance before committing your expensive sublimation paper.
It is also worth noting the licensing implications if you plan to sell finished goods. Most designers allow you to sell the physical item you create (the ornament), but you cannot resell the digital file itself or claim the artwork as your own. Reading the specific terms included in the ZIP file is a crucial step for any entrepreneur to avoid legal headaches down the road.
